So let's take a look at the causes of blood in urine in women and what are the symptoms?

If hematuria is accompanied by long-term frequent urination, urgent urination, and painful urination, it is more likely to be renal tuberculosis. If hematuria is accompanied by edema of the eyelids, face or whole body, increased blood pressure and fever, it may be acute nephritis. If hematuria is accompanied by severe frequent urination, urgent urination and painful urination, it is mostly acute cystitis. If hematuria is accompanied by low back pain symptoms, sometimes severe paroxysmal low back pain - renal colic, it may be kidney or ureteral stones. People over 40 years old with hematuria without obvious symptoms and pain may have urinary system tumors. If hematuria is accompanied by bleeding in other parts of the body, it may be caused by blood disease.

1. Urinary system diseases: such as urinary stones, pyelonephritis, cystitis, prostatitis, kidney tumors, hereditary kidney disease, renal vascular diseases, effects of chemical drugs, exercise-induced hematuria, etc.

2. Diseases of organs adjacent to the urinary tract: acute appendicitis, salpingitis, pelvic inflammatory disease, pelvic abscess and pelvic tumors, tumors of the rectum and colon.

3. Blood disease: Friends who are concerned about why women urinate blood should also undergo a blood test if necessary. Hematuria is accompanied by bleeding from multiple parts of the skin and orifices, sometimes accompanied by fever.

4. Systemic diseases: seen in blood diseases such as allergic purpura, thrombocytopenic purpura, aplastic anemia, leukemia, etc.; connective tissue diseases such as systemic lupus erythematosus, scleroderma, polyarteritis nodosa, etc.; infectious diseases such as meningitis, leptospirosis, scarlet fever, etc.; cardiovascular diseases such as hypertensive nephropathy, congestive heart failure, etc.; endocrine diseases such as gout, diabetes, hyperparathyroidism, etc.
